臺灣各縣市治安評比模式建置

Developing a Public Security Ranking Model for Taiwan Counties

指導教授 : 車振華
若您是本文的作者,可授權文章由華藝線上圖書館中協助推廣。

摘要


近年來,隨著臺灣政治、社會、經濟結構快速的變遷,伴隨著許多日趨嚴重的社會問題,使人民對生命、財產安全,感到不安,其中治安及犯罪問題更是目前社會最重要的議題。 治安的好壞,長久以來不僅是政治、政黨爭論的焦點,更是社會大眾評量警察工作優劣的重要指標。有鑑於此,為瞭解台灣地區近年來的犯罪型態趨勢問題,實有必要針對警政署之各種統計資料加以比較分析。以瞭解並預測我國犯罪狀況在區域上之數量及質量的變化趨勢。然而目前各縣市治安評比之研究僅以此統計數據來排序,並無客觀的評比各刑案類別的權重,使得每一刑案類別的嚴重程度視為一致,故需發展一客觀評估各縣市之治安評比模式。為解決此問題,本研究結合FAHP與TOPSIS求取影響各縣市治安相關因子之權重,並運用視覺化決策球之排序方法,評比各縣市治安優劣排序,以提供各縣市政府與警政機關在評估警政績效與警力配置上之參考。

並列摘要


The quality of Public Security has been the focus regard of political, political parties and is more measured assessment community police work priorities an important indicator. Therefore, we have to understand the trends of crime patterns in Taiwan. However, the current Evaluation of Public Security of each county, that only use the statistical data to study sort, they don’t an objective evaluate of the weight in criminal categories. It makes the severity of each category of criminal cases as the same. Therefore, we need to develop a county assessment model of Public Security. To assist each county searching for optimum Public Security, this study will combine FANP and TOPSIS to obtain the right weight of related factors in affecting counties. And use the decision ball, as the decision of the sort method. Pros and cons of rating counties sort order to provide county and city governments and police authorities in the assessment of police performance and police are deployed on the reference.
